IN a recent communication, Marsh and Thompson1 showed that strips of sheep muscle frozen before the onset of rigor mortis could be made to shorten by different amounts by varying the rate of thawing. They further showed that if the muscle shortened by more than 50 per cent of its original length it exuded much fluid, and they concluded that the cell membranes had been ruptured by the excessive contraction, the muscle entering what has been called the delta state.
